I have changed my login window to be an xterm by modifying the ttys file. I notice that for some of the MIT applications in /usr/bin/X11, when they are closed with the "Close" entry on my window menu (to quit the application), I get an endless stream of Error messages from the Server related to XKillClient. The application does not die until I manually kill it from another window. This is particularly a problem when I run a script from my login window to start the window manager and all of my xterms. When I log out, the error messages never end (unless I rlogin from another machine and kill all of the hung applications) Is this a known server problem and are there any solutions?
